Wheels?
I'm new to rx7's and have a dumb question. I'm looking to purchase some wheels, and would really like to get a low offset wide wheel. Does anyone know what the limits are without rolling the fenders? The car is a 3rd gen.
Any help would be great! Thanks!!

FD's need a high offset like +45 or +50mm to maximize the width of wheel under a stock fender.
